Description:
The Outdoor DAS and Small Cell Implementation course streamlines the implementation process, illustrates key considerations for each step, and highlights external factors and the material impact.
Topics will include access rights and easements for street furniture and pole attachments, relevant standards and codes for compliant implementation, and best practices around the implementation of all system components.
The course also teaches ideal practices for installing small cells on utility poles. With over 75% of small cells expected to be placed on utility poles, special considerations need to be addressed when installing cellular equipment above the power lines.
